Question : What is Myrmecology?
Option 1: Study of flies
Option 2: Study of ants
Option 3: Study of bees
Option 4: Study of spiders
Correct Answer: Study of ants
Solution : The correct answer is the Study of ants.
Myrmecology is a discipline of entomology that focuses on the scientific study of ants. The scientific study of bees is known as Melittology.
Question : What is the smallest 6-digit number that is completely divisible by 108?
Option 1: 100003
Option 2: 100004
Option 3: 100006
Option 4: 100008
Correct Answer: 100008
Solution : Given: Divisor = 108 The smallest six-digit number is 100000. Divide 100000 by 108, Quotient = 925, Remainder = 100 Required number = 100000 + (108 – 100) = 100008. Hence, the correct answer is 100008.

Question : If $a= \frac{\sqrt{x+2}+\sqrt{x-2}}{\sqrt{x+2}-\sqrt{x-2}}$, then the value of $(a^{2}-ax)$ is:
Option 1: 1
Option 3: –1
Option 4: 0
Correct Answer: –1
Solution : To solve $(a^{2}-ax)$, we first need to calculate the value of $a$: $a= \frac{\sqrt{x+2}+\sqrt{x-2}}{\sqrt{x+2}-\sqrt{x-2}} \times \frac{\sqrt{x+2}+\sqrt{x-2}}{\sqrt{x+2}+\sqrt{x-2}} = \frac{2x+2\sqrt{x^2-4}}{4}= \frac{x+\sqrt{x^2-4}}{2}$ ⇒ $2a=x+\sqrt{x^2-4}$ ⇒ $2a-x=\sqrt{x^2-4}$ Squaring both sides, we have, ⇒ $4a^2+x^2-4ax=x^2-4$ ⇒ $a^2-ax=-1$ Hence, the correct answer is –1.
